https://github.com/pioug/gulp-terser
Gulp plugin for terser
https://github.com/pioug/gulp-terser
gulp-plugin javascript minification minifier terser
Last synced: 3 months ago
JSON representation
Gulp plugin for terser
- Host: GitHub
- URL: https://github.com/pioug/gulp-terser
- Owner: pioug
- License: mit
- Created: 2020-03-21T16:25:08.000Z (about 5 years ago)
- Default Branch: master
- Last Pushed: 2022-12-02T20:52:29.000Z (over 2 years ago)
- Last Synced: 2025-03-05T15:59:01.266Z (3 months ago)
- Topics: gulp-plugin, javascript, minification, minifier, terser
- Language: JavaScript
- Homepage:
- Size: 606 KB
- Stars: 0
- Watchers: 2
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
# gulp-terser 
## Install
```sh
$ npm install github:pioug/gulp-terser#3.0.0
```### Example
```js
const gulp = require("gulp");
const sourcemaps = require("gulp-sourcemaps");
const terser = require("gulp-terser");
const terserOptions = {
compress: {
drop_console: true,
passes: 2,
},
output: {
comments: false,
},
};gulp
.src("script.js")
.pipe(sourcemaps.init(terserOptions))
.pipe(terser())
.pipe(sourcemaps.write(""))
.pipe(gulp.dest("build"));
```- See https://github.com/terser/terser for more minification options
- See https://github.com/gulp-sourcemaps/gulp-sourcemaps for advance usage of sourcemaps